Generally, every sail-powered vessel over eight feet in length and every motor-driven vessel (regardless of length) that is not documented by the U.S. Coast Guard which is used or on the waters of this state are subject to registration (California Certificate of Ownership (title)) by the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). Part of the process of buying a boat from another individual is getting the boat title transferred from the seller's name into your name. However, if the watercraft was titled by the seller(s), you must surrender the original properly endorsed watercraft certificate of title issued in the seller's name(s). Well my project boat has hit a wall, I have the bill of sale from the owner of the repair shop that I bought it from (was being sold due to the owner couldn't pay) and from the info I had, and was told by my buddy, I could go to the SOS (DMV) and with the bill of sale and hull id # they would look it up and make sure everything is all good and title it in my name, well last week that did not happen, I was told I need the title or have it bonded by an insurance company.
